A technical issue prevented users with specific access rights from viewing leave information in the Attendances Gantt View. This update corrects a rare access error that occurred when calculating leave intervals, ensuring all users can accurately see approved leave on the Gantt chart. The fix adds a temporary access layer to ensure correct calculations.

Version: - 19.0 Steps to reproduce: - Install Attendances and Time Off - Create an internal user. - Give the user: Attendances Officer access & No Time Off Officer/Manager rights - Create an employee linked to the user. - Configure the employee with a Flexible Working Schedule. - Create and approve a Time Off request for the employee. - Open: Attendances -> Gantt View - Navigate to the month containing the employee's approved leave. Issue: - An access error is raised when opening a month that contains the employee's approved leave. Cause: - In `_handle_flexible_leave_interval`, the code accesses `leave.holiday_id` to read fields such as `request_unit_half`, `request_unit_hours`, and `request_hour_from/to` on the `hr.leave` model. - When the current user has Attendances Officer rights but no Time Off access(rare cases), the ORM access check on `hr.leave` raises an AccessError, even though this read is purely for internal calendar computation and does not expose leave data to the user interface. Fix: - Added sudo() on holiday_id to access the employee's leave details and compute the work interval as expected. Task-6264510 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/enterprise#119116
This update corrects a bug where inactive or archived taxes were incorrectly displayed in the bank reconciliation process. The fix ensures that users only see active taxes when reconciling bank statements, improving data accuracy and preventing potential errors in financial reporting. This resolves issue OPW-6245641.
Original PR description
### Issue:
When editing a line within the bank reconciliation widget, inactive and archived taxes are incorrectly available for selection
### Cause:
The bank reconciliation edit line form view carried the `{'active_test': False}` context on the `tax_ids` field
This context allowed archived taxes to be loaded and selected during creation and manual edition
### Fix:
Explicitly force `active_test: True` in the view context for the tax field to ensure only active taxes can be searched and selected by the user
### Steps to reproduce:
- Install `account_accountant`
- Create a new tax and set it to inactive
- Go to the Bank Reconciliation widget
- Create a bank statement line
- Set the account to 600000 Expenses
- Edit the line by clicking on the pencil icon
- Open the Taxes selection dropdown
Before the fix, the inactive tax is visible and available for selection by default

Before this commit, when a new task was created in `project.task`, its creation message spanned two lines: "task created" and "task created for project XYZ". This commit unifies them into one to avoid confusion. The first line was caused by the message template having a description attribute. Even though editing the description will not fix the issue for existing databases, we chose to target the earliest possible version that a new customer might start from. The problem does not exist in 19.0. task-5999819

The reconcile badge counts draft and posted journal items, but the matching dialog forces a posted filter by default, this makes the dialog show fewer lines than count as it discards the draft ones. Remove the default posted search filter so the dialog displays all matching items. task-6234801 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/enterprise#118146

On mobile, an unwanted caret was displayed next to the message 'Expand' button in the Inbox because the messaging menu itself opens a dropdown, causing any nested Dropdown to automatically display a caret. This commit also fixes the alignment of the Inbox header action buttons, which wrapped onto multiple lines when opening the messaging menu on mobile while the Inbox tab was already selected. In this case, the `AutoresizeInput` width was computed at its maximum size, leaving insufficient space for the header action buttons and causing them to wrap onto multiple lines. Steps to reproduce: - Configure user A to receive inbox notifications. - As user B, invite user A to follow a record with Notify recipients enabled. - Open the inbox of user A. The Invitation to follow notification is not displayed in the inbox when no additional comment is provided. This happens because the notification body is empty unless extra comments are added. This commit fixes the issue by displaying only the subject when the body is empty. **STEP TO REPRODUCE** 1. Create an invoice with a unit price of 10.005 and qty of 2. 2. Send the invoice to ksef. 3. Open the xml and notice P_9A (unit price) is 10.00 and P_11 (total without tax) is 20.01 Which is inconsistent (10.00 * 2 =/= 20.01). This PR increase the decimal places of P_9A to 8 digits which is the maximum allowed by the FA(3) format. Note that Ksef doesn't verify the untaxed unit price * quantity = total without tax, so the invoice we send are technically valid. However, it's best to generate invoice where the numbers add-up. opw-6203896 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#263812

Steps: - Create a product with a barcode "12345" - Create a sale order - Add a product - search product with name "12345" without copy/pasting - no result - try with copy/pasting - 1 result The problem is due to the fact that there is an optimization in Many2XAutocomplete.search which means that if no results are found for “1234,” it will not search for “12345.” However, product override name_search to returns a product only when the name is exactly equal to its barcode (`=` and not `ilike`), which does not work at all with search optimization. Currently, an error will occur when user multi edits name of projects.
Steps to replicate:
- Install `project` and open projects.
- From the list view select multiple projects and edit their name.
Error:
```
File '/home/odoo/src/odoo/saas-19.3/addons/project/models/project_project.py', line 754, in write
analytic_account_to_update.write({'name': self.name})
File '/home/odoo/src/odoo/saas-19.3/odoo/orm/fields.py', line 1728, in __get__
record.ensure_one()
File '/home/odoo/src/odoo/saas-19.3/odoo/orm/models.py', line 5341, in ensure_one
raise ValueError('Expected singleton: %s' % self)
ValueError: Expected singleton: project.project(8, 9, 10)
```
Cause:
- As multiple records were changed at the moment, `self` had multiple recordsets and trying to access `self.name` [1] causes this error.
Solution:
- Avoided accessing `self.name` on a multi-recordset during multi-edit.
- Updated analytic account names using the name recieved in the vals.

Currently, when user multi-edits projects names from list view the linked folder name doesnt get updated. Steps to replicate: - Install `documents_project` and open projects. - Select multiple projects and edit their names. Issue: - The project names get updated but their respective linked folder's name doesnt get updated. Cause: - During multi-edit, `self.documents_folder_id` contains the folders of all selected projects. - As a result, `len(self.documents_folder_id.project_ids) == 1` [1] is evaluated on the combined recordset instead of per project, causing the condition to fail whenever multiple projects are renamed. Solution: - Avoided accessing `self.name` on a `multi-recordset` during multi-edit. - Filtered projects individually and updated their document folders using the name in vals. `_compute_component_ids` unconditionally called `bom.explode()` for every product variant on the BoM, even for quality point types (`instructions`, `pass_fail`, etc.) that never use the `component_id` picker. The field is only meaningful for `register_consumed_materials` and `register_byproducts`. Restrict the expensive path to those two types with an `elif` so all other types return `component_ids = False` immediately. | # Input data | Before PR | After PR | |:---:|:---:|:---:| | 10 variants, 10 components, 2 phantom BoMs, 3 ops | 841 ms | 0.1 ms | | 30 variants, 20 components, 5 phantom BoMs, 3 ops | 1,343 ms | 0.1 ms | | 80 variants, 40 components, 12 phantom BoMs, 5 ops | 8,674 ms | 0.1 ms | OPW-6210368 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/enterprise#118470

_get_sync_partner excludes partners whose email matches a configured alias, returning a list shorter than the emails/google_attendees lists. zip() stops at the shortest, silently dropping the last Google attendee instead of the alias-matched one. Fix by replacing the positional zip with a by-email dict lookup, so each attendee is resolved independently and only the unresolvable one is skipped. opw-6086240 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#263787

When opening a profile from the avatar card, the employee's company may not be in the user's active companies. Until now this popped a confirmation dialog that only let the user either activate the other company or cancel, with no way to reach the still-accessible contact profile. Replace the dialog with a less intrusive "View Profile" dropdown, shown only when the employee's company is allowed but not active. It offers two choices: - Open Employee Profile (activates the company) - Open Contact Profile (no company activation) Activating an extra company widens the active-company scope for the whole session, which is not always desirable, so keeping a non-mutating path to the contact profile is useful. The new collected_values UBL import flow sets product_uom_id from the XML unitCode without checking that the resolved UoM category matches the matched product's UoM category. When they diverge, writing the line triggers the incompatible error. Steps to reproduce: - Create a product "XYZ" with UoM "Units" (category "Unit"). - Import a Peppol UBL bill whose line has Item/Name "XYZ" and unitCode="MTK" (uom_square_meter, "Surface"). - Import fails with: "The Unit of Measure (UoM) 'm²' you have selected for product 'XYZ', is incompatible with its category : Unit." This fix will avoid setting the product_uom_id when the UoM category doesn't match the product's UoM category, allowing the line to be imported without error. The user can then manually set the correct UoM after import. opw-6121714 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#269933 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#269714

The aim of this commit is to move _get_iap_url on res.company model instead of pdp.regitration. This move is made for 2 reasons: 1. PDP registration is a transient model which means that the object could be deleted in the time. 2. PDP registration implementation was using the model (api.model) and the record (self.edi_mode) which is a bad implementation. So by moving this function on company, we ensure that we always have a record to call the function and then the function is no longer an api.model. no task id --- I confirm I have signed the CLA and read the PR guidelines at www.odoo.com/submit-pr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#270345
